Chapter 3

I looked again at Kenzie's cabinet filled with luxury items. There were handbags, shoes, and a collection of limited-edition cosmetics.

Each one came from my business partners. Kenzie and Colton seemed to have swept up every item I disliked each season.

I clapped my hands with a smile and said, "Impressive. You are really something. You are sure that I never look at the things I don't like, so you've been shamelessly rummaging through my leftovers. That's all you're good for—picking up things I don't want."

"Elianna!" Colton finally exploded.

He rushed in front of me and snatched away the crystal cup. His voice trembled with anger. "You've trespassed into my home and meddled with my things. Get out immediately!"

"Your home?" I looked at him and enunciated each word slowly. "Colton, who paid for this house?"

The living room fell silent for a moment.

Every guest's eyes turned toward Colton and me. Those young people who were laughing and joking just moments ago now held their breath.

Colton's gaze started darting around. He was clearly guilty.

He then leaned in and whispered a warning, "Stop making a scene. Go home quickly. Remember, the company's stock prices have been volatile lately. It's only stable because of me."

Suddenly, it all clicked. So that was why he was so bold.

I had intended to restructure the company's shares, so I had collaborated with the upper management on a year-long scheme to make everyone think I was losing influence in the company.

Even my poor husband, Colton, could overshadow me.

I hadn't yet caught the seasoned schemers in the company, but unexpectedly, I uncovered Colton's affair.

He was so eager to control me after he just got 30 percent of the shares.

I was amused by my discovery. But before I could say more, Jaxton interrupted us. "Mr. Thomas, who exactly is this woman?"

Colton gritted his teeth.

I saw cold sweat forming on his forehead as his fingers unconsciously clenched. His suit sleeves trembled slightly.

But in the next moment, he took a deep breath and seemingly made up his mind. He said loudly, "She's the caregiver I hired when my mother was ill."

"What?" A collective gasp filled the room.

Everyone looked at me with shock and disdain in their eyes. They seemed to be watching an overambitious fool.

Colton seemed to start a good story and continued more smoothly, "She looked after my mom for three years. We pitied her and took extra care of her. But when she saw my family's wealth, she started pestering me relentlessly."

He pointed at me and said firmly, "She insists on using the favor of caring for my mother as leverage to force me to marry her. I've rejected her multiple times, yet she is not willing to give up. She even chases me here today."

Kenzie immediately played along. She squeezed out tears as she clung to Colton's arm and said with trembling sobs, "Is that true? Colton, why didn't you tell me sooner? Have you been harassed by her for three years? Oh my God. That's terrifying..."

She turned to me, and her eyes were filled with tears. "Please, ma'am, stop pestering him. We're truly in love. Could you let us be?"

Her acting was impressive.

If it weren't for the inappropriate setting, I'd want to applaud her with my hands on her face.

Jaxton's gaze shifted from disdain to disgust. "I knew it. She is dressed so poorly, just aiming for something out of reach."

His female companion chimed in, "Take a look at yourself. Mr. Thomas would never be interested in a caregiver like you. Just leave now. Stop embarrassing yourself here."

Colton took a deep breath and seemed to have made up his mind. He avoided my gaze and gestured towards the door.

Jaxton caught on immediately and showed a ruthless expression. He shouted towards the door, "Security, are you deaf? Didn't you hear Mr. Thomas's words? Drag this troublemaking woman out."

Several uniformed security guards quickly streamed in, armed with batons. They surrounded me with unfriendly expressions.

"What are you doing?" I asked coldly.

"What are we doing? We're escorting you out." The lead guard reached to grab my arm.

I sidestepped, but another guard shoved me from behind.

I stumbled forward, and my knee slammed onto the floor. The pain from the freshly healed wound turned my vision dark.

"Hold her down," Jaxton shouted from the side. "Don't let her touch anything here again."

Several guards swarmed over and eagerly twisted my arms and dragged me towards the door.

My coat was torn in the struggle, and my hair was disheveled.

"Let go of me." I struggled desperately. But against their numbers, my efforts were futile. In the chaos, someone jabbed a baton into my abdomen, and it was activated. The dull pain caused me to curl up instantly. I convulsed and lost strength.

They pushed me into the villa's courtyard fiercely.

I landed heavily on the stone path outside. The old wounds compounded with new ones made me gasp out of pain. I couldn't muster the strength to stand. Watching the blood spread from my knee, I almost fainted.

The music in the living room had stopped. Those guests crowded at the door and the large windows. They were pointing at me like I was a spectacle.

A few seconds later, Colton seemed to make up his mind.

He pushed through the crowd and walked towards me, step by step.
